Output eb81c0b169a14a121378f621b470a4ee0f5a13f77e87eeee073d102fe463b9d6:178

value
3266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 824f9bbf1450005a842505a1f0ede56c22b1bc557b672fbabf2419da49f887df
address
bc1psf8eh0c52qq94pp9qkslpm09ds3tr0z40dnjlw4lysva5j0csl0spmwuml
transaction
eb81c0b169a14a121378f621b470a4ee0f5a13f77e87eeee073d102fe463b9d6
confirmations
92368
spent
true